Bulls Eye Software, LLC
Our Updated Software Development Principles:

  • Embrace and leverage modern object-oriented technology and frameworks.
  • Adopt an Agile development approach, emphasizing continuous delivery and collaboration with stakeholders.
  • Follow industry best practices and coding standards while adapting to evolving conventions.
  • Optimize for performance and scalability while prioritizing code readability, maintainability, and testability.
  • Leverage automation and DevOps practices for seamless integration, deployment, and maintenance.
  • Design for modularity, reusability, and composability to facilitate code sharing and reduce duplication.
  • Ensure security and privacy considerations are integrated into the development process.
  • Prioritize user experience and usability, seeking user feedback throughout the development lifecycle.
  • Stay updated with emerging technologies and consider their applicability in the software development process.
By aligning with these modern trends, the software development principles can be better suited for current practices and industry standards.